Spisu treści:

NeoMatrix 8x8 Word Clock: 6 kroków (ze zdjęciami)
NeoMatrix 8x8 Word Clock: 6 kroków (ze zdjęciami)

Wideo: NeoMatrix 8x8 Word Clock: 6 kroków (ze zdjęciami)

Wideo: NeoMatrix 8x8 Word Clock: 6 kroków (ze zdjęciami)
Wideo: How to build a DIY Word Clock Display with Adafruit Neomatrix 2024, Czerwiec
Anonim

Fascynuje Cię upływ czasu? Czy chcesz dodać stylowy, nowoczesny i funkcjonalny zegarek do swojej kolekcji zegarów? Zegar słowny jest jedynym w swoim rodzaju urządzeniem do określania czasu, wykorzystującym siatkę liter do określenia czasu. Chociaż możesz wydać tysiące dolarów na inne wersje tego pomysłu, ten projekt jest niedrogim i szybkim sposobem na zbudowanie go dla siebie.

Zegar słowny wykorzystuje Adafruit NeoPixel NeoMatrix 8x8 do stworzenia kolorowego zegara słownego! W związku z tym zawiera oryginalny układ liter 8x8 w celu utworzenia wszystkich różnych fraz czasowych. Można go zasilać przez USB, dzięki czemu świetnie sprawdza się na biurku. Ten zegar korzysta również z zestawu przerwania zegara czasu rzeczywistego DS1307, dzięki czemu zachowuje czas nawet po odłączeniu! DS1307 ma dokładność +/- 2 sekundy dziennie, a zegar wskazuje czas z dokładnością do pięciu minut. Płytka mikrokontrolera, której używamy, to Pro Trinket 5V, ale można ją zamienić na dowolny kompatybilny z Arduino lub mikrokontroler, który może korzystać z I2C i NeoPixels.

Krok 1: Lista części

Części

  • Błyskotka Pro 5V
  • DS1307 Zestaw tabliczki zaciskowej z zegarem czasu rzeczywistego
  • NeoPixel NeoMatrix 8x8
  • Wycinana laserowo obudowa akrylowa Wordclock
  • 4-40 czarnych nylonowych śrub (x14)
  • 4-40 czarnych nakrętek nylonowych (x14)
  • 2-56 czarnych śrub maszynowych SS (x2)
  • 2-56 Czarna nakrętka sześciokątna SS (x4)
  • Przewody, silikonowa osłona są najłatwiejsze w użyciu, ale wystarczy prawie każdy ~22-26 AWG
  • Kabel microUSB (do wgrania kodu i zasilania zegara)
  • Zasilanie portu USB 5V 1A (jeśli nie chcesz tylko zasilać zegara z komputera)

Narzędzia

  • Komputer, który może zaprogramować Trinket Pro 5V
  • Lutownica
  • Lutować
  • Narzędzia do ściągania izolacji
  • Frezy ukośne
  • Mały śrubokręt płaski (2,4 mm)

Krok 2: Montaż obwodu

Montaż obwodu
Montaż obwodu
Montaż obwodu
Montaż obwodu
Montaż obwodu
Montaż obwodu
Montaż obwodu
Montaż obwodu

Zacznij od złożenia płytki zaciskowej zegara czasu rzeczywistego DS1307, postępując zgodnie z tym przewodnikiem. Wystarczy wlutować męskie złącza dla GND, 5V, SDA i SCL. Możesz pominąć SQW, ponieważ nie jest używany, a nagłówek nie będzie dobrze pasował do Pro Trinket. Jeśli go wlutujesz, możesz odciąć dolny przewód.

Po złożeniu złącza DS1307 z nagłówkami można go przylutować do Trinket Pro 5V, aby DS1307 GND zrównał się z Pro Trinket A2, 5V z A3, SDA z A4 i SCL z A5. Upewnij się, że deski są ustawione prawidłowo! SDA i SCL muszą być podłączone odpowiednio do A4 i A5.

Podłącz NeoMatrix GND do Trinket Pro GND, 5 V do 5 V i DIN do Pin 8. Przetnij przewody o długości 5-8 cali lub 13-20 centymetrów. Przylutuj przewody z tyłu NeoMatrix, aby przewody nie były widoczne z przodu.

Krok 3: Podłącz obwód

Podłącz obwód
Podłącz obwód
Podłącz obwód
Podłącz obwód
Podłącz obwód
Podłącz obwód

Teraz, gdy obwód jest gotowy, nadszedł czas, aby zacząć mocować go do obudowy wycinanej laserowo. Musisz znaleźć warsztat do cięcia laserowego, przestrzeń dla hakerów lub innego przyjaciela z laserową wycinarką do wycinania kawałków. Możesz znaleźć pliki do wycięcia w tym repozytorium github, użyj przezroczystego i czarnego akrylu 1/8 - lub wykaż się kreatywnością i zrób coś innego!

Zacznij od przymocowania matrycy neopikselowej do akrylowej płytki, która utrzyma ją na miejscu w obudowie.

Teraz weź tylny panel i przymocuj śruby maszynowe ze stali nierdzewnej, które utrzymają Pro Trinket na miejscu. Przymocuj Pro Trinket do tylnej płyty, upewniając się, że śruby są mocno dokręcone.

Połącz matrycę neopikselową z tylną płytą z panelem bocznym, uważając, aby użyć panelu z otworem na micro USB.

Teraz możesz dodać drugi panel boczny oraz górną i dolną część, mocując każdy za pomocą czarnych nylonowych śrub.

Po złożeniu wszystkich przezroczystych elementów akrylowych możesz dodać osłonę pikseli i dyfuzor.

Krok 4: Złóż obudowę

Zamontuj obudowę
Zamontuj obudowę
Zamontuj obudowę
Zamontuj obudowę
Zamontuj obudowę
Zamontuj obudowę

Umieść osłonę pikseli na górze siatki neopiksela. Pomoże to zatrzymać światło z każdego piksela, dzięki czemu każda litera na zegarze będzie wyraźniejsza i łatwiejsza do odczytania.

Dyfuzory służą do rozpraszania światła z neopikseli i ułatwiają czytanie tekstu na płycie czołowej. Możesz zrobić dyfuzor ze zwykłego arkusza papieru lub innego materiału, który wyrównuje jasne światło z neopikseli. Wystarczy prześledzić zarys matrycy neopikselowej i wyciąć go.

Umieść dyfuzor na wierzchu matrycy neopiksela. Teraz jesteś gotowy do zamocowania płyty czołowej. Przed założeniem płyty czołowej zdejmij papierową osłonę ochronną z płyty czołowej. Wszelkie fragmenty listu należy wyciągnąć razem z papierem. Użyj pęsety, aby wyłuskać fragmenty liter, które nie wypadają podczas ściągania papieru.

Krok 5: Prześlij kod

Prześlij kod
Prześlij kod

Przełącz Pro Trinket w tryb bootloadera, odłączając i ponownie podłączając Pro Trinket do komputera za pomocą kabla MicroUSB lub naciskając przycisk resetowania. Dostęp do przycisku resetowania może być trudny lub niemożliwy, jeśli przylutowałeś RTC na górze lub jeśli już zainstalowałeś obwód w obudowie! Dlatego uważam, że podłączenie płyty do USB działa najlepiej.

Gdy czerwona dioda LED na Pro Trinket pulsuje, płyta jest w trybie bootloadera. Gdy jesteś w trybie bootloadera, prześlij kod! Jeśli wszystko zostało zrobione poprawnie, powinien zacząć podawać czas!

Krok 6: Ciesz się zegarem Wordclock

Ciesz się swoim Wordclockiem!
Ciesz się swoim Wordclockiem!
Ciesz się swoim Wordclockiem!
Ciesz się swoim Wordclockiem!
Ciesz się swoim Wordclockiem!
Ciesz się swoim Wordclockiem!

Rozkoszuj się swoim osiągnięciem.

Siostrzane instrukcje montażu można również znaleźć w systemie Adafruit Learn.

Zalecana: